Norwich City and Aston Villa in transfer discussions for forward

Image de l'article :Norwich City and Aston Villa in transfer discussions for forward

Norwich City have confirmed that they are in negotiations with Aston Villa over re-signing winger Lewis Dobbin.

Norwich City remain without a permanent manager at Carrow Road as they head into what is expected to be a busy summer transfer window, but the Canaries have confirmed that they are in talks to re-sign Lewis Dobbin from Aston Villa.

Johannes Hoff Thorup was sacked by the club with just a couple of games to go of the 2024/25 Championship campaign as they continued to drift into the middle-of-the-table following a 3-1 defeat to Millwall at The Den on Easter Monday.

Jack Wilshere was placed in interim charge but, having been overlooked for the vacancy, the former Arsenal midfielder is set to leave the club having been first-team coach for the season. The likes of Ralph Hasenhuttl and Russell Martin remain the front-runners for the post with the bookies.

Despite no manager being in place, they have continued with recruitment for the summer, led by Sporting Director Ben Knapper, and Dobbin is someone they want to see return to Norfolk.

Aston Villa forward Lewis Dobbin wanted again at Norwich City for 2025-26 season

In the announcement of their retained list, Norwich confirmed that they were in discussions with Aston Villa over the potential of re-signing England youth international forward Dobbin.

Whilst they did specify that they were also in talks to sign Jacob Wright from Manchester City on a permanent deal following his loan stint at the club, Norwich said that the talks around Dobbin were in regard to the potential extension of his loan deal.

The Canaries also confirmed that Callum Doyle, who has spent the season on loan from the Cityzens, will return to his parent club, whilst both Archie Mair and Jonathan Tomkinson will depart the club this summer following the expiry of their contracts.

As well as youngsters Mair and Tomkinson, senior players such as Angus Gunn, Jacob Sorensen and Onel Hernandez have also departed with Jonathan Rowe’s loan move to Olympique de Marseille now becoming a permanent one.

Lewis Dobbin’s stint at Norwich City showed promise - a loan return could be beneficial

Stoke-born Dobbin, who has represented England at U16, U17 and U19 level, came through the academy at Everton and eventually made 20 appearances for the Toffees before his departure last summer.

The former Derby County loanee was sold to Villa for a fee believed to be in the region of £9 million last year, but he was immediately loaned out to West Bromwich Albion, where he spent the first-half of this season.

After making just one start with no goals or assists during his time at The Hawthorns, he moved to Norwich on a temporary basis in the winter transfer window and went on to make ten appearances for the club in the Championship with a couple of goals there against Swansea City and Stoke City.

The 22-year-old has made a bright start to life at Norwich, becoming a regular for a team that, at the time of his injury, were still flirting with making a tilt at the top six and the play-off places in the Championship.

A calf injury sustained against Blackburn Rovers in early March saw him miss the rest of the campaign, but his impact was such that Norwich now appear keen on keeping him at Carrow Road.
